Unlocking the ZTE ZXV10 B866V2 (often distributed by ISPs like Claro or PTCL) typically involves bypassing provider-imposed restrictions to install third-party apps or completely flashing a new custom firmware. High-Level Methods for Unlocking

There are two primary approaches depending on your goal and technical comfort level: 1. The "Jump" Method (App Sideloading)

This is the easiest "soft" unlock that doesn't require hardware modification. It bypasses the locked home screen to let you use the Play Store and other apps.

Factory Reset: First, perform a factory reset via Settings > Device Preferences > About > Factory Reset.

Voice Search Bypass: During the initial setup, there is often a brief window (about one minute) where voice commands work. Use the remote's voice button and say "Open Play Store".

Remapping Keys: Once in the Play Store, quickly download an app like Button Mapper. Assign a rarely used key (like a color button) to open "Settings" or a custom launcher. This allows you to bypass the locked provider home screen by simply pressing that button.

Enable ADB: Go to Settings > About and click "Build Number" seven times to enable Developer Options. Then, enable USB Debugging to install apps via a PC. 2. Full Firmware Flash (Custom ROM)

To completely remove provider branding and restrictions, you must flash a clean Android TV ROM. Note that this model often requires hardware interaction.

Hardware Prep: Some methods for the B866V2 require opening the box to access specific test points on the motherboard for "mask ROM" mode.

Tools Needed: A PC, a USB Burning Tool (Amlogic), and a compatible firmware image (such as the "Vietnam Multilanguage ROM" or a "Clean Android 12" build). Process: Connect the TV box to your PC via a USB-A to USB-A cable. Use the Amlogic USB Burning Tool to load the new firmware.

Short the designated points on the PCB (refer to specific schematic diagrams for your board revision) to trigger the flash. Risks and Considerations

Warranty: Opening the device or flashing unofficial firmware will void your warranty and may violate your ISP agreement.

Bricking: Incorrect flashing can permanently disable the device. Ensure the firmware you download is specifically for the B866V2 variant.

Unlocking the ZTE ZXV10 B866V2 (and its variants like the B866V2F or B866V2K) allows you to transform a restricted operator-provided set-top box into a versatile, high-quality Android TV media center. Many of these devices, originally distributed by providers like Claro, MTS, or PTCL, come with locked bootloaders and disabled developer options that prevent the installation of third-party apps.

By using free custom ROMs and specialized tools, you can bypass these limitations and enjoy a cleaner, more powerful streaming experience. Why Unlock Your ZTE B866V2?

Unlocking provides several high-quality benefits that the standard operator firmware lacks:

Freedom from Subscriptions: Convert a "paperweight" device into a standard Android TV box after canceling your ISP contract.

Full App Compatibility: Install the Google Play Store, Netflix, YouTube, and other streaming apps without operator restrictions.

Customization: Change the launcher, background, and system settings to suit your preferences.

Performance Optimization: Remove "bloatware" that slows down the device's Amlogic S905X2 processor and 2GB RAM. Requirements for the Unlock Process

To achieve a high-quality unlock for free, you will typically need the following tools:

Amlogic USB Burning Tool: The standard software used to flash custom .img firmware files onto Amlogic-based devices.

Male-to-Male USB Cable: Necessary to connect the STB to your PC for flashing.

Custom Firmware (ROM): Look for clean "Android TV" or "Full visible" ROMs specifically designed for the B866V2 hardware.

Pin Shorting (Optional): Some versions of the B866V2 require "shorting" specific pins on the motherboard to enter Maskrom mode or Fastboot for flashing. Zte Zxv10 B866v2 Unlock High Quality //free\\

To install high-quality custom ROMs (like Android 12) or root the device, you must unlock the bootloader.

Developer Mode: Go to Settings > About TV and tap Build seven times until "Developer options" are enabled.

The Hidden Toggle: In Developer Options, enable USB Debugging and OEM Unlocking. Freedom to choose your network : With an

The PC Connection: Connect the box to a PC using a USB male-to-male cable.

Fastboot Command: Use Android Platform Tools to run the command:fastboot flashing unlockNote: This will perform a factory reset, erasing all data on the box. The Transformation: Installing Custom ROMs

Once unlocked, you can move away from restrictive firmware to "clean" versions of Android TV.

Android 9 to 12: Newer methods allow users on Android 9 to bypass intermediate versions and flash directly to Android 12 custom ROMs.

ROM Sources: Community developers like Mauro Valle often share free ROMs that remove carrier bloatware and add custom backgrounds.

Method: Most ROMs are flashed using the Amlogic USB Burning Tool on a PC, requiring you to hold the physical reset/power button on the box while connecting it to the computer until it stays on the logo screen. Important Safety Checklist 4K High-End Android TV STB — ZXV10 B866V2-H | ZTE
